42-5732 The mugger
Son of Don Weir, Jon Weir of Vero Beach, Florida
(YB-40) Delivered Tulsa 29/10/42; Biggs 15/3/43; Orlando 29/4/43; Presque Is 3/5/43 Assigned Keck Prov BG; Assigned 327BS/92BG Alconbury, t/o Goose Bay for Meeks Fd, where pilot found poor weather and decided to press on for UK, and low on gas, crash landed Brenish, Isle of Lewis, UK 7/5/43; Salvaged & taken to Stornaway; with Paul Casey, Co-pilot: Don Weir, Navigator: Jim Combest, Flight engineer/top turret gunner: Grover Groff, g-Henry Finagar, Karl Waldoogal (6 Returned to Duty); Returned to the USA 28/3/44; 3036 BU Yuma 4/5/44; Reconstruction Finance Corporation (sold for scrap metal in USA) Ontario 18/5/45.
